Technical Overview:

FastPage 3 is a CGI (Common Gateway Interface) application. It is installed on the web server, either in a shared cgi-bin directory or as a subdirectory of the website that will use it. Once installed and configured, only a web browser is required to edit the content of web pages (or other text-only format documents) on the web server.

FastPage is written in perl and was designed to have as few system requirements as possible. It is the intention of the developers of FastPage to provide a product that will run on any platform. Although there are more modern tools for creating web applications, perl is perfect for FastPage because of its wide support on multiple platforms. FastPage is only run (executed) when pages are updated, so FastPage enabled websites do not add any performance overhead to the operation of the website like some dynamic content-driven technologies.

Any document (web page or other text-only format file) that resides on the web server can be edited with FastPage. Usernames and passwords are assigned for each document using the included web-based FastPage Profile Manager.

Web pages are 'FastPage enabled' by inserting special FastPage tags in the body of the document around the content that will be 'editable.' As the developer, you determine what parts of the website people can edit, so you can be sure that nothing else will be touched or accidentally broken.

The FastPage Editor can be customized to display a different header and footer. Each element of the FastPage editor has features that can be changed including the size of the input boxes for each field type and more. Advanced tracking tools like system logging and page update email notification are available in the standard FastPage configuration file on all versions of the software.
